블록체인 기술의 기본 원리와 작동 방식

블록체인 기술, 그 기본 원리와 작동 방식을 알아보자

블록체인 기술은 최근 몇 년 동안 다양한 산업에서 주목받고 있는 혁신적인 기술입니다. 특히, 금융 거래에서부터 물류, 의료까지 여러 분야에서 활용되고 있죠. 오늘은 블록체인 기술의 기본 원리와 작동 방식을 깊이 있게 탐구해보겠습니다.

암호화폐 안전하게 보관하는 방법을 알아보세요.

블록체인이란 무엇인가?

블록체인은 데이터를 블록 단위로 묶어서 체인처럼 연결한 형태의 데이터베이스입니다. 각 블록은 여러 트랜잭션 정보를 담고 있으며, 이전 블록과의 연결을 통해 전체 체인을 구성합니다. 블록체인의 가장 큰 특징은 탈중앙화입니다. 중앙 집중식 시스템이 아닌 여러 참여자들이 정보를 공유하고 검증하므로 투명성과 보안성을 높일 수 있죠.

블록체인의 기본 구성 요소

블록체인은 여러 중요한 구성 요소로 이루어져 있습니다.

  1. 블록(Block): 데이터를 담고 있는 기본 단위입니다. 각 블록은 고유한 해시값을 가지고 있으며, 이전 블록의 해시값도 포함되어 있습니다.
  2. 체인(Chain): 블록들이 서로 연결된 형태입니다.
  3. 노드(Node): 블록체인 네트워크에 참여하는 각 컴퓨터를 의미합니다.
  4. 트랜잭션(Transaction): 블록체인에서 발생하는 데이터 전송입니다.

VPN의 작동 원리와 보안 효과를 알아보세요.

블록체인의 작동 원리

블록체인은 다음과 같은 단계로 작동합니다.

1. 트랜잭션 생성

사용자가 블록체인 네트워크에서 트랜잭션을 생성합니다. 예를 들어, A가 B에게 Bitcoin을 송금하고자 할 때, A의 지갑에서 트랜잭션을 생성합니다.

2. 트랜잭션 검증

트랜잭션이 생성되면, 네트워크에 있는 여러 노드가 이를 검증합니다. 이 과정은 합의 알고리즘을 기반으로 이루어집니다. 가장 많이 사용되는 알고리즘은 작업 증명(Proof of Work)과 지분 증명(Proof of Stake)입니다.

3. 블록 생성

트랜잭션이 유효하다면, 이를 블록에 추가합니다. 여러 트랜잭션이 모여 하나의 블록이 형성되죠.

4. 블록의 추가

형성된 블록은 기존 블록체인에 추가됩니다. 이때, 이전 블록의 해시값을 포함하여 체인의 무결성을 보장합니다.

5. 완결

노드에 의해 블록이 추가되면, 모든 사용자에게 업데이트된 블록체인이 전송됩니다.

쿠팡 로지스틱스의 자동화로 물류 혁신을 이끌어낸 비법을 알아보세요.

블록체인의 장점

블록체인 기술은 다양한 장점을 가지고 있습니다.

  • 투명성: 모든 트랜잭션은 네트워크에 공개되기 때문에 누구나 확인할 수 있습니다.
  • 보안성: 데이터가 암호화되어 저장되며, 변경하기 어렵기 때문에 안전합니다.
  • 탈중앙화: 중앙 기관 없이도 운영되므로 시스템의 중단 위험이 줄어듭니다.

금융 인증 거래의 안전성을 쉽게 이해해 보세요.

블록체인의 활용 사례

블록체인은 다양한 분야에서 활용되고 있습니다. 몇 가지 사례를 살펴보겠습니다.

1. 금융 산업

블록체인은 금융 거래의 안전성을 높이고, 송금 시간을 단축시킵니다. 예를 들어, Ripple과 같은 암호화폐가 실시간으로 송금할 수 있는 환경을 제공합니다.

2. 물류 산업

물류 물품의 이동을 추적할 수 있는 시스템을 구현하여 투명성을 높입니다. IBM과 Maersk가 협력하여 만든 TradeLens 플랫폼이 대표적입니다.

3. 의료 산업

환자의 의료 기록을 블록체인에 저장하여 언제 어디서나 접근할 수 있도록 하고, 데이터의 위조를 방지할 수 있습니다.

전자카드 제도로 인한 개인정보 유출 위험, 자세히 알아보세요.

블록체인 기술의 한계

이러한 장점에도 불구하고 블록체인에는 몇 가지 한계가 존재합니다.

  • 확장성 문제: 모든 트랜잭션을 검증해야 하므로 대규모 트랜잭션 처리에 한계가 있습니다.
  • 에너지 소비: 작업 증명 방식은 많은 에너지를 소모합니다.
  • 규제 문제: 각국 정부의 규제가 커질 가능성이 있습니다.
장점 단점
투명성 확장성 문제
보안성 에너지 소비
탈중앙화 규제 문제

결론

블록체인 기술은 금융, 물류, 의료 등 다양한 분야에서 혁신을 이끌고 있습니다. 하지만 이 기술이 성공적으로 자리 잡기 위해서는 한계를 극복하고 더 많은 연구가 이루어져야 합니다. 따라서, 블록체인 기술에 대한 이해를 높이고, 이를 활용할 수 있는 방법을 고민해보는 것이 중요합니다. 기술의 발전을 지켜보며 앞으로의 변화를 함께 준비해보세요!

자주 묻는 질문 Q&A

Q1: 블록체인이란 무엇인가요?

A1: 블록체인은 데이터를 블록 단위로 묶어 체인처럼 연결한 형태의 데이터베이스로, 탈중앙화된 시스템입니다.

Q2: 블록체인의 작동 원리는 어떤가요?

A2: 블록체인은 트랜잭션 생성, 검증, 블록 생성, 블록 추가, 그리고 완결의 단계를 통해 작동합니다.

Q3: 블록체인의 장점은 무엇인가요?

A3: 블록체인의 장점으로는 투명성, 보안성, 그리고 탈중앙화가 있습니다.